I recently purchased the Les Shoppes DSP and was keen to chop into it, hooray for Calypso Coral being one of the colours in the papers. I chose one of the shops from the papers and roughly cut around it before gluing it to some Thick Whisper White card. I then fussy cut it for the front of the card. This gives the paper some firmness when it's popped up on Dimensionals. We don't want a saggy building!

I really liked the astronaut from Reach For The Stars stamped in the bright colours. It's absurdly fun, don't you think? It made me think of the artwork of Andy Warhol, so my card deviated a little from the original to make it more like the pop art style of Warhol's.

scissorspapercard, CASEing The Catty, Stampin' Up! Reach For The Stars, Stargazing DSP

I used my Stamparatus to stamp the astronaut image. I wanted it to be exactly the same in each square, so it was the perfect tool for the job. I stuck with the colours from the original card - Lemon Lime Twist, Berry Burst and Orchid Oasis - and added Calypso Coral for the fourth colour.

scissorspapercard, CASEing The Catty, Stampin' Up! Reach For The Stars, Stargazing DSP

I used the coordinating Stargazing DSP on the base of my card, and to matt the sentiment. I cropped a square out of the middle of the DSP where it won't be seen under the art panel and used a piece of it for the matt. Just a little trick to stretch your supplies further.

I pulled an old stamp and die set, Happy Birthday To You, off my shelf and stamped the cake image on Shimmery White paper using Stazon ink so that I could watercolour the image. I used Pool Party for the cake and the other two colours for the blooms.
